[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Re: connexion distante à un serveur mysql



On 06/11/2010 08:20 PM, corbie@free.fr wrote:
Le vendredi 11 juin 2010, JC a écrit :
corbie@free.fr wrote:
Lorsque je tape en mode console : mysql -h<IP_serveur_mysql_distant>  -u root -p
"access denied"
Si je tape en mode local, devant le serveur mysql  : mysql -u root -p
je suis connecté.
Quel fichier de configuration dois-je renseigné ?
---------------------------
Il ne faut pas regarder les fichiers de conf mais la table user de la base Mysql.
La 1ère colonne indique si l'utilisateur est local ou autre IP ...
Si local tu ne peux qu'en local : sécurité par défaut je crois.
grant all privileges on baseBABA.* to BABA@localhost identified by
'PASSWORDBABA';
L'utilisateur BABApeut se loguer sur la base BABA et acceder à toutes ses
tables à partir de localhost uniquement.
Indique machine.domain.net à la place de localhost si tu veux pour voir te
connecter depuis la machine machine.domain.net ou utilises une IP
Jean-Claude
----------------------------------------------------------------------------
# mysql -h debian-salon -u root -p
Enter password:
ERROR 1130 (00000): Host '192.168.1.4' is not allowed to connect to this MySQL server

Et j'ai bien sur toutes mes bases :  "all privileges"   root    debian-salon=192.168.1.4

# mysqlaccess -h debian-salon -u root -d starinux -p
Password for MySQL user root:
Sorry,
An error occured when trying to connect to the database with the grant-tables:
* Maybe YOU do not have READ-access to this database?

Bizarre ...

Par curiosité, tu peux afficher la commande "grant" que tu as utilisée ?



Reply to: